Scottish Statutory Instruments

2018 No. 301

Housing

The Registered Social Landlords (Repayment Charges) (Scotland) Regulations 2018

Made

3rd October 2018

Coming into force

27th October 2018

The Scottish Ministers make the following Regulations in exercise of the powers conferred by sections 174A(1) and 191(2)(b) of the Housing (Scotland) Act 2006(1) and all other powers enabling them to do so.

In accordance with section 174A(3) of that Act, the Scottish Ministers have consulted such bodies representing local authorities, such bodies representing registered social landlords and such other persons as they think fit.

In accordance with section 191(5) of that Act(2), a draft of these Regulations has been laid before, and approved by resolution of, the Scottish Parliament.

(1)

2006 asp 1 (“the 2006 Act”). Section 174A was inserted by section 85(3) of the Housing (Scotland) Act 2014 (asp 14) (“the 2014 Act”).

(2)

Section 191(5) was relevantly amended by section 85(4) of the 2014 Act.

Policy Note

Policy Note sets out a brief statement of the purpose of a Scottish Statutory Instrument and provides information about its policy objective and policy implications. They aim to make the Scottish Statutory Instrument accessible to readers who are not legally qualified and accompany any Scottish Statutory Instrument or Draft Scottish Statutory Instrument laid before the Scottish Parliament from July 2012 onwards. Prior to this date these type of notes existed as ‘Executive Notes’ and accompanied Scottish Statutory Instruments from July 2005 until July 2012.
